Shop

Fresh Neem Leaves 50g

2,00 

Availability:In stock

🎁 Purchase & earn 2 IIF Coins

2,00 

Availability:In stock

Add to cart
Buy Now
Weight0,02 kg
0
Please Enter Your Postcode
X